> MavenMan wrote:
>> I want to rename upload file in my action .I code :
>> 
>>   FormFile file=form.getUserphoto();
>>   file.setFileName(String.valueOf(date.getTime()));
>> but error is :javax.servlet.ServletException: The setFileName() method is
>> not supported.
>> 
>> what can I do ?
>> thanks in advance !
> 
> The file in the form is a temporary file, so if you need it to remain on 
> disk beyond the lifetime of the request you'll need to manually copy its 
> content into a new file in an appropriate place.
